Being technically proficient is a given in accounting, but nowadays it is simply not enough. You must be able to differentiate yourself as an individual and as an organization, by becoming an invaluable trusted advisor to your clients. It is also to understand the core elements of trust and how behaviors can either strengthen it or undermine it. In this session, we’ll take a non-traditional approach to building long-lasting, authentic workplace relationships based on the principle that it starts with self-awareness, both internal (how we see ourselves) and external (how others see us). Raising self-awareness reduces reactivity, which allows us to listen better and communicate with intention. By developing a clearer consciousness of self, understanding and managing trust, and applying the basics of conscious communications, leaders can achieve stronger, more dynamic and holistic client relationships that last.
Objective
At the end of this session, attendees will have learned the value of empathic listening toward the achievenment of long lasting client relationships.
Highlights
• Understand the difference between having good intentions and being intentional, and how intention is the foundation of effective communication • Identify the components and subtleties of trust, and actively manage trust in client relationships • Learn the basics of empathic listening and why it is critical to developing deep and long-lasting client relationships
